Output 72c37324dbfc24da8d572d07bbb7ea7839f7013ae833538bafbcae08bbb83fe6:0

value
3676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f41ecc5a8f1cceb9bf44b7182af2fc304717d9e OP_EQUAL
address
335h2xobKdq1BcvFyUMWcbfvZeuzvB35Ns
transaction
72c37324dbfc24da8d572d07bbb7ea7839f7013ae833538bafbcae08bbb83fe6
confirmations
165429
spent
true